IEC 61881-2:2012
Railway applications - Rolling stock equipment - Capacitors for power electronics - Part 2: Aluminium electrolytic capacitors with non-solid electrolyte

Overview of IEC 61881-2:2012
The scope of IEC 61881-2:2012 is centered on aluminium electrolytic capacitors used in power electronic equipment for rolling stock. In practice, it serves as a primary technical reference for assessing suitability, performance expectations, and conformity assessment activities tied to railway electrical equipment.
